Forum |  HardWare.fr | News | Articles | PC | S'identifier | S'inscrire | Shop Recherche
2397 connectés 

  FORUM HardWare.fr
  Programmation
  PHP

  Type de données SQL non attendu !?

 


 Mot :   Pseudo :  
 
Bas de page
Auteur Sujet :

Type de données SQL non attendu !?

n°1709934
redvivi
Posté le 30-03-2008 à 19:45:23  profilanswer
 

Bonjour à tous !!
 
    J'utilise ce code là pour récupérer quelques enregistrements SQL:
 

Code :
  1. $messages = mysql_query("SELECT * FROM message WHERE id='".$_GET['id']."'" );
  2. while ($valeur_recup_infos = mysql_fetch_assoc($messages)){
  3. $ID = $valeur_recup_infos['id'];
  4. $EXPEDITEUR = $valeur_recup_infos['expediteur_message'];
  5. $DESTINATAIRE = $valeur_recup_infos['destinataire_message'];
  6. $DATE = $valeur_recup_infos['date'];
  7. $HEURE = $valeur_recup_infos['heure'];
  8. $SUJET = $valeur_recup_infos['sujet'];
  9. $MESSAGE = $valeur_recup_infos['message'];
  10. $STATUT = $valeur_recup_infos['statut'];
  11. }


 
id est bien évidemment passé en variable dans l'URL. Voici les erreurs associées:
 

Code :
  1. Warning: mysql_fetch_assoc(): supplied argument is not a valid MySQL result resource in showmessage.php on line 11
  2. Notice: Undefined variable: EXPEDITEUR in showmessage.php on line 25
  3. Notice: Undefined variable: DATE in showmessage.php on line 26
*  Notice: Undefined variable: HEURE in showmessage.php on line 26
  4. Notice: Undefined variable: MESSAGE in showmessage.php on line 43


 
Pourquoi ces erreurs apparaissent ? Je pense avoir utilisé le bon mysql_fetch pourtant !
 
Merci @ tous !
RedVivi

mood
Publicité
Posté le 30-03-2008 à 19:45:23  profilanswer
 

n°1709946
skeye
Posté le 30-03-2008 à 20:03:38  profilanswer
 

ta requête doit retourner une erreur...affiche mysql_error()...


---------------
Can't buy what I want because it's free -
n°1709953
redvivi
Posté le 30-03-2008 à 20:16:26  profilanswer
 

J'ai juste essayé de faire un echo "SELECT ....." et j'ai bien la requete que je veux, j'ai essayé celle-ci dans mysql qui fonctionne (elle me retourne une ligne de plusieurs colonnes)

n°1709961
skeye
Posté le 30-03-2008 à 20:24:43  profilanswer
 

bah en attendant php te dit que le paramètre que tu fournis à mysql_fetch_assoc est mauvais...


---------------
Can't buy what I want because it's free -
n°1710001
redvivi
Posté le 30-03-2008 à 22:03:56  profilanswer
 

Quel con....j'ai oublié le fichier de connection.....merci en tout cas !


Aller à :
Ajouter une réponse
  FORUM HardWare.fr
  Programmation
  PHP

  Type de données SQL non attendu !?

 

Sujets relatifs
[Abstraction] Votre idée sur la classe "C_Mot" ou le type "T_Mot"Accéder aux données d'un autre domaine en Javascript
Problème pour faire une requête SQL.Extraire les bonnes données
[SGBD/SQL] Utiliser un index ? Quand ? Comment ?Creer un systeme de base de donnees poru jeux flash
Filtrage de type de fichier dans la fenetre d'upload..._
XQuery ? (Séléctions de données)[Builder 6]récpere le résultat d'une requête SQL d'un composant TQuery
Plus de sujets relatifs à : Type de données SQL non attendu !?


Copyright © 1997-2022 Hardware.fr SARL (Signaler un contenu illicite / Données personnelles) / Groupe LDLC / Shop HFR